Benefits of Green Crude

Environmental and Sustainable

Sapphire Energy's process requires two main inputs—sunlight and CO2. It uses nonpotable, salt water and grows on nonarable land in desert climates and therefore does not impact fresh water resources or lands needed to grow food crops.

Efficient

Algae are the most efficient photosynthetic plants on the planet as no energy goes into making roots, stems, seeds, or flowers. More energy (roughly 6-50 times more) is produced per acre, per year, with algae versus other feedstocks.

Low Carbon Impact

Algae consume CO2 in the process of growing. Every gallon of algae crude oil takes in 13 to 14 kg of CO2. Sapphire's Green Crude has a well to wheels life cycle carbon impact that is roughly 70% less than fossil-based fuels, and significantly lower than other conventional biofuels.

A Complete Drop-in Replacement

Sapphire Energy's Green Crude is a complete “drop-in” transportation fuel and has equivalent or better energy density than the fossil fuels we currently use. It is compatible with the existing energy infrastructure, including the network of refineries, pipelines, distribution centers and the current fleet of cars, trucks, and jets.

Scalable

Sapphire's scalable production facilities can grow easily and economically because production is modular, fueled by sunlight, and is not constrained by land or other natural resources.
